 Some people really feel like the ideas and imagery inside themselves  isn't worthy of being shown. They take these fractions of their heart  and soul, and set it on a weight with decision, and they will question  over and over.
 

'What if I'm wasting my time?'
                        'What if someone laughs at me or hates it?'
'What if it's not perfect?'
                    'What if this is a mistake?'
'What if I just don't take a chance?'
 

They look back and forth on this weighing, as if their very expression  needs enough tokens to be considered real. As if whatever inside  themselves is either not worthy, or not necessary enough to be given a  chance. Don't be fooled here. I need you to give yourself a chance.
 

All of this around you..it's not a contest. It's not a smooth plain of  symmetry and expected construct where only the idea of perfection  thrives. It's organic,it's messy, it's alive, it's human, it's  expressive..it's you.
 

I want you to try removing some of that weight off the scale now and  again. I know some people would disagree with that. That we must have a  fear in ourselves, or that to be better we must be uncomfortable and  unhappy with what we do to push forward. I say.....no...
 

I say a lot of us didn't have this weight when we were younger. When we  were just kids, and all we wanted to do was create colors and shapes on  slips of white voids. We're creative...and we need little excuse to be. I  hope you remember that now and again, because when you begin to move  that weight..you might be left with the question " What can I lose? "  indeed..what can you..?
